On Mon, 4 Mar 1996, Behzad SAFARI wrote:

> I have a some files which thier names contain more 8 caracteres in 
> UNIX system. What i do to portabilite my files in MS_DOS without 
> changing thier names ?

You should make sure the filenames are all unique in their first 8
characters of the basename (sans the extension), or that the first 3
characters of the extension are different.  For example, these filenames
will be different on DOS: 

	file1-long.extension-long
	file2-long.extension-long
	file1-long.another-one

while these filenames cannot be distinguished under DOS and will make 
trouble:

	filename1-long.extension-long
	filename2-long.extension-long

There is a package called DOSCHK on GNU ftp sites (get the file
doschk-1.1.tar.gz) which will help you verify that all your filenames
won't make trouble under DOS.
